Iranian football outfit Sepahan SC has completed the signing of Iraqi international striker Marwan Hussein Al-Ajeeli, local media reported on Wednesday.
Hussein has joined the Isfahan-based club on a two-year contract for an undisclosed fee, reports Xinhua news agency.
Al-Ajeeli is a member of Iraq's Al-Shorta at the moment and will join Sepahan after the end of the Iraqi Premier League season.
The 25-year-old striker has played 11 times for the Iraq national football team.
Sepahan has also recently signed a contract with Brazilian defender Jairo Rodrigues Peixoto Filho.
